North America Tea-Based Skin Care Market to Grow with a CAGR of 7.14% through 2030
The
North America tea-based skincare market is growing rapidly, driven by
increasing consumer interest in natural ingredients, and demand for antioxidant-rich
tea extracts boosts product development, especially in moisturizers and serums.
According to
TechSci Research report, “North America Tea-Based Skin Care Market – By
Country, Competition, Forecast & Opportunities, 2030F”, the North America Tea-Based Skin Care
Market was valued at USD 67.15 million in 2024 and is expected to reach USD
101.20 million by 2030 with a CAGR of 7.14% during the forecast period. The
North American tea-based skincare market is witnessing significant growth,
driven by a surge in consumer preference for natural, clean, and eco-friendly
beauty products. Tea-based ingredients, particularly green tea, chamomile, and
white tea, are gaining popularity due to their antioxidant, anti-inflammatory,
and soothing properties, making them ideal for a variety of skincare concerns,
including acne, aging, and irritation. This shift is largely due to an
increasing awareness of the harmful effects of synthetic chemicals in
traditional skincare products, prompting consumers to seek out more
plant-based, effective, and safer alternatives.
Green
tea has particularly emerged as a key ingredient in this market due to its
powerful antioxidant properties, which help combat oxidative stress and protect
the skin from environmental damage caused by pollution and UV exposure.
Additionally, green tea’s anti-inflammatory benefits make it an ideal choice
for consumers with sensitive or acne-prone skin. As a result, many skincare
brands are incorporating green tea into their product formulations, ranging
from cleansers and toners to moisturizers, serums, and masks. The expanding use
of green tea in skincare products has led to a rise in demand for these
offerings, as consumers are increasingly attracted to products that deliver
visible results without harsh chemicals.
Another
prominent trend is the clean beauty movement, which has propelled the demand
for tea-based skincare products. Clean beauty is defined by the absence of
toxic ingredients, such as parabens, sulfates, and synthetic fragrances, and
consumers are becoming more discerning about the products they use. Tea-based
skincare fits perfectly into this category, as tea extracts are naturally
sourced, non-toxic, and free from harmful additives. This growing preference
for clean, transparent, and sustainable products has led many beauty brands to
emphasize the purity of their formulations and promote the environmental
benefits of tea as a sustainable ingredient.
Despite
its rapid growth, the North American tea-based skincare market faces certain
challenges. One of the primary challenges is the high level of competition from
both traditional skincare brands and other natural, plant-based beauty
products. As more brands enter the market, differentiating products based on
unique benefits and ingredient transparency becomes increasingly important.
Additionally, the market is also facing challenges in terms of consumer
education, as many consumers are still unaware of the specific skincare
benefits of different types of tea. This requires brands to invest in educating
their consumers about the unique advantages of tea-based products over
conventional skincare alternatives.
Sustainability
is also playing a crucial role in the growth of the tea-based skincare market.
Consumers are becoming more environmentally conscious and are seeking brands
that prioritize sustainable sourcing and eco-friendly packaging. Tea, as a
plant-based ingredient, is seen as an environmentally sustainable option
compared to synthetic chemicals, and many brands are focusing on responsible
sourcing practices, such as fair trade certifications and organic farming.
Additionally, the shift toward sustainable packaging, including recyclable or
biodegradable containers, is in line with consumers' increasing desire for
eco-friendly products. This trend is expected to continue as more brands adopt
sustainable practices in response to consumer demand.

The Noth America
Tea-Based Skin Care market is segmented into product, distribution channel and country.
Based on the distribution
channel, the online segment is the fastest-growing in the North American
tea-based skincare market, driven by increasing consumer preference for the
convenience of e-commerce. Online platforms offer a wider range of products,
personalized recommendations, and the ability to research ingredients and
reviews. The growth of beauty-specific online retailers and direct-to-consumer
brands further accelerates this trend, allowing tea-based skincare products to
reach a larger audience and cater to the rising demand for plant-based, clean
beauty solutions. This shift towards digital shopping is reshaping consumer
purchasing behavior, contributing significantly to the market's expansion.
Based
on country, Canada is the fastest-growing country in the North American
tea-based skincare market, driven by increasing consumer interest in natural,
clean beauty products. Rising awareness about the benefits of tea-infused
skincare, such as green and chamomile tea, is fueling demand. Canadians are
increasingly embracing eco-friendly and sustainable skincare options, aligning
with the growing trend of clean beauty. Additionally, the expansion of
e-commerce platforms and access to a wide range of tea-based skincare products
are contributing to this growth, as consumers seek convenient, plant-based
solutions to address various skin concerns.
Major companies
operating in the North America Tea-Based Skin Care Market are:
- Amorepacific Corporation.
- Purity Cosmetics (100% PURE)
- L'Oréal S.A.
- Unilever Plc
- Skinyoga International LLP
- Organic Tea Cosmetics Holdings Co Ltd
- Gipefi Cosmetics Inc
- Virgin Scent, Inc (ArtNaturals)
- Avon Products, Inc.
- Origins Natural Resources Inc.
